    Li & Fung is a Hong-Kong based company that provides value-added services across the entire supply chain. Li & Fung has been operating for about a century. It was founded in Guangzhou‚ china‚ in 1906 by Fung Pak-Liu and Li To-Ming. Li & Fung was a family owned business until the 1970s where it transformed into a public company that is professionally managed.
